What is a Protein Simple?

Protein Simple is not a job title, but rather a biotechnology company that develops and manufactures instruments and tools for protein analysis, such as western blotting, capillary electrophoresis, and immunoassays. If you are inquiring about roles at Protein Simple, these can include research scientists, application specialists, and engineers who design, test, and support protein analysis instruments used in life sciences and pharmaceutical research. Employees at Protein Simple typically have backgrounds in biology, biochemistry, or engineering and work to improve and innovate technologies for protein characterization.

What are some common challenges faced by scientists working with the Protein Simple platform, and how can these be addressed?

Scientists using the ProteinSimple platform often encounter challenges such as optimizing assay conditions for different protein samples and troubleshooting instrument errors. These challenges can typically be addressed by thoroughly reviewing protocol guidelines, collaborating with colleagues for shared troubleshooting tips, and utilizing the technical support resources provided by the manufacturer. Additionally, keeping detailed records of sample preparation and instrument settings can help streamline troubleshooting and improve reproducibility. Team-based problem-solving and ongoing training are also valuable for staying current with best practices.

What are the key skills and qualifications needed to thrive as a Protein Simple Field Application Scientist?

To thrive as a Protein Simple Field Application Scientist, you need a solid background in biochemistry or molecular biology, often supported by a master's or Ph.D. and hands-on experience with protein analysis. Proficiency in using ProteinSimple instruments (like Simple Western, Maurice, or Ella), data analysis software, and relevant laboratory information management systems is crucial. Strong presentation, troubleshooting, and customer service skills help you communicate complex information and support clients effectively. These abilities are vital for delivering scientific expertise, ensuring customer satisfaction, and driving successful adoption of advanced protein analysis technologies.

The laboratory of Dr. Ian Willis is seeking a highly motivated research technician to support basic research and preclinical studies of gene expression and protein function using engineered mouse models with enhanced health span or neurodegenerative disease.  The work is focused on the RNA polymerase (Pol) III system, its production of RNA molecules at the center of the Central Dogma of Molecular Biology and the health and disease impacts of mutations in this machinery. We employ genetics, biochemistry, cell and molecular biology and omics technologies in mouse models to understand disease pathogenesis and to test potential therapeutic approaches aimed at improving patient care and enhancing health.
